Wauneta’s Yucca Hills MX Track hosts NCMA Motocross season

The Nebraska Cornhusker Motocross Association (NCMA) held a full weekend of motocross action June 9-10 at Yucca Hills MX Track north of Wauneta.
    Yucca Hills was slated to hold the NCMA season’s second competition on April 15. Because of winter weather those races were postponed until June 9.
    Events over the weekend included Open Outlaw; Mini Open and Pit Bikes; Women B and C; Open 65; Vet A, B and C; Pee Wee Open; 250 C; 65 (ages 6-8) and 65 (age 9-11); 250 A and B; Pee Wee (ages 4-6) and Pee Wee (ages 7-8); Open Am and Over 40; 85 (ages 7-11) and 85 (ages 12-16); and 450 Open A, B and C.
    Riders can enter multiple events. Friday, 97 race enteries were filled and 103 slots were filled on Saturday.
    Saturday was the series’ fourth race of the season. The season opened April 8 at Arapahoe, followed by April 29 at Alma. Several of the season’s events have been postponed due to weather.
